]> shimmer.witbreuk.eu Git - UltimateKEYS.git/blobdiff - README.md
Create dummy
[UltimateKEYS.git] / README.md
index bf7bcc256357127b322e26d6a6bdb3ad7ae75ee3..609acd6c218b413f346154827fc5f18651eb84b4 100644 (file)
--- a/README.md
+++ b/README.md
@@ -1,18 +1,19 @@
-# UltimateKEYS Keyboard Layout (Windows)
-International US-QWERTY layout with AltGr dead keys via AutoHotkey script and compiled KLC version (Windows).
+# UltimateKEYS Keyboard Layout (Windows/Linux)
+International US QWERTY layout with AltGr (Right Alt) dead keys via AutoHotkey script (Win), MSKLC source (Win) and XKB integration (Linux).
 
 
-In UltimateKEYS, all keys remain exactly organized as US-QWERTY. Except, when AltGr or AltGr+Shift is pressed in combination with another key, other diacritics and symbols are accessible and some keys become dead keys.
+In UltimateKEYS, all keys remain exactly organized as US QWERTY. Except, when `AltGr` (`Right Alt`) or `AltGr+Shift` (`Right Alt + Shift`) is pressed in combination with another key, other diacritics and symbols are accessible and some keys become dead keys.
 
 
-In that way, it is - somehow - similar to the layout "United States-International" (on Windows), although this project moves all dead key combinations to the modifiers AltGr and AltGr+Shift. That way, this project solves the most typical issues, among which the quotes (' and ") can be used as usual (without pressing the spacebar afterwards), while the acute accent (´) and diaeresis (¨) are found under AltGr and AltGr+Shift respectively. This project has borrowed several aspects from the EurKEY Keyboard Layout (by Steffen Brüntjen).
+In that way, it is - somehow - similar to the layout "United States-International" (on Windows), although this project moves all dead key combinations to the modifiers `AltGr` and `AltGr+Shift`. That way, this project solves the most typical issues, among which the quotes (' and ") can be used as usual (without pressing the spacebar afterwards), while the acute accent (´) and diaeresis (¨) are found on `AltGr+'` and `AltGr+Shift+"` respectively. This project has borrowed several aspects from the EurKEY Keyboard Layout (by Steffen Brüntjen).
 
 
-## Script for AutoHotkey
+## Script for AutoHotkey (Windows)
 
 
-This AutoHotkey script is a highly customizable version of UltimateKEYS. To work properly, the Windows keyboard has to be set to standard US-QWERTY and at least AutoHotkey 1.1 (AutoHotkey_L) is required.
+This AutoHotkey script is a highly customizable version of UltimateKEYS. To work properly, the Windows keyboard has to be set to standard US QWERTY and at least AutoHotkey v1.1 (preferably as 'Unicode 64-bit', on 32-bit Windows as 'Unicode 32-bit') is required.
 
 - **AutoHotkey website :  https://www.autohotkey.com/**
 
 - **AutoHotkey website :  https://www.autohotkey.com/**
-- **Download the 'UltimateKEYS - YYYY-MM-DD.ahk' file from this repository.**
-- **After AutoHotkey is installed, you can optionally put the AHK file in the 'Startup' folder.**
-- **Please note :  this is an overlay script, specifically designed for the keyboard layout 'US-QWERTY'.**
+- **Install the latest release of the current v1.1 branch (preferably as 'Unicode 64-bit', on 32-bit Windows as 'Unicode 32-bit').**
+- **Download (and run) the 'UltimateKEYS - YYYY-MM-DD.ahk' file from this repository.**
+- **Optionally, you can put the AHK file in the 'Startup' folder to launch at startup.**
+- **Please note :  this is an overlay script, specifically designed for the keyboard layout 'US QWERTY'.**
 
 ## Download the latest release
 
 
 ## Download the latest release
 
@@ -23,6 +24,20 @@ This AutoHotkey script is a highly customizable version of UltimateKEYS. To work
 - **https://pieter-degroote.github.io/UltimateKEYS/documentation.html**
 - **https://pieter-degroote.github.io/UltimateKEYS/**
 
 - **https://pieter-degroote.github.io/UltimateKEYS/documentation.html**
 - **https://pieter-degroote.github.io/UltimateKEYS/**
 
-## Enjoy and have fun !
+## MSKLC integration (Windows)
+
+An MSKLC source file is available for integration on Windows OSes (although not recommended on Windows 10 and not recommended in a production environment).
+
+## XKB integration (Linux)
+
+Experimental support for GNU/Linux via XKB integration (X11) :  see the 'linux' folder in this repository.
+
+Follow these steps for experimental integration (at your own risk!) :
+
+- Download the files `ultkeys` and `rule.xml` from the 'linux' folder.
+- Copy `ultkeys` to `/usr/share/X11/xkb/symbols` (root required).
+- Paste the contents of `rule.xml` to either `/usr/share/X11/xkb/rules/evdev.xml` or `/usr/share/X11/xkb/rules/evdex.extras.xml`, this between the tags `<layoutList>` and `</layoutList>` (root required).
+
+## Enjoy and have fun ! &nbsp;- &nbsp;Veel plezier ! &nbsp;☺
 
 Pieter Degroote
 
 Pieter Degroote